BOVEY TRACEY and Dartmouth meet at Mill Marsh Park tonight (6.30pm) for what is one of their most important games of the season, writes Mike Sampson.

Victory for either side is likely to be enough to ensure that they avoid relegation from the Premier Division and it is more than likely that Bovey will not be resting any players on this occasion.

"It's like a cup final for both sides and it probably will be a case of who deals with the pressure the best," said Dartmouth manager Lance Worthington.

"We were superb against Tavistock but then let ourselves down against Ivybridge but to be fair I had four of my regulars missing for the last game and they will all be available tonight," revealed the Darts boss.

Radley Veale, Andy Widdicombe, Chris Hooper and Chris Harrity all return and go straight into the squad of 15 that travels to Bovey.

Bovey will have several new faces in their squad for the game with former Argyle professional Ben Gerring coming into the Moorlanders defence, whilst former Torquay United striker Ellis Laight will start up front in this vital game.

Midfielders Richard Groves and Steve Orchard are also included and will give managers Kevin Moyle and Steve Massey more options.

Left back Nic Barker returns to the fold and he could be joined by Gary Fisher provided he came through Dawlish's Easter games unscathed.

"It's all about survival and we feel that three points would be enough to keep us up," admitted Massey.

"I was asked to come to Bovey to help keep them up and that is my intention and I will use all the means at my disposal to achieve that aim," he revealed.
